(1)As used in this article, unless otherwise required
by the context:
(a)Administrator means the administrator designated in section 5-6-103.
(b)Advertisement means a commercial message in any medium that aids,
promotes, or assists, directly or indirectly, a rental purchase agreement.
(c)Cash price means the price at which a lessor in the ordinary course of
business would offer the property that is the subject of a rental purchase
agreement to the lessee for cash on the date of the execution of the rental
purchase agreement.
(d)Consummate means the act of the lessee in entering into a rental
purchase agreement.
(e)Lessee means a natural person who rents personal property under a
rental purchase agreement.
